Clinicians should not offer saccadic or smooth-pursuit exercises as specific exercises for gaze stability to individuals with unilateral or bilateral vestibular hypofunction. Each hemisphere is responsible for ipsilateral smooth pursuit eye movements, meaning the right hemisphere detects and tracks images as they move to the right and the left hemisphere detects and tracks images as they move to the left.
